Hi Jigar,

create the JD first, prepare the KPI & KRA

you can evaluate the perfomance on the basis of wiegtage alloted to each KPI.

for eg., kpi of ana accountant

timely calculation and filling of taxes(cst , stetc)  30

calculation of salary                                                  15

 handling petty cash                                                 15

bank reconcilliation                                                  20

debit note/ credit note                                              20

total                                                                            100

on the basis on quqrterly evaluation you can give star performer etc if he gets above 95 % in every review / evluation.
